About the Role

MedZed is seeking a highly skilled and compassionate Community Health Navigator to join our team. As a Community Health Navigator, you will play a vital role in connecting our members with essential healthcare services and resources.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ist members with complex healthcare needs, including those who are homeless, have severe mental illnesses, or are in need of preventive services.
  • Enroll members in programs and services, effectively communicating their value and benefits.
  • Work with members to provide effective and efficient service coordination, including on-site and in-home assessments.
  • Develop personalized service plans and guides with members and healthcare providers, focusing on health management goals.
  • Engage members in achieving health management goals through health coaching, motivational interviewing, and problem-solving techniques.
  • Assist members in overcoming barriers to meeting health goals and update service plans accordingly.
  • Arrange for member transportation to healthcare services appointments and accompany members as needed.
  • Follow up with members via phone calls, home visits, and visits to other settings where members can be found.
  • Collaborate with social service agencies to address member needs, including housing, food, clothing, and financial assistance.
  • Maintain accurate, quality, timely, and consistent documentation in our company database of member activities and interventions.
  • Achieve set goals and key performance indicators (KPIs).
  • Continuously expand knowledge of community resources, services, and programs available to members and build ongoing relationships with these organizations to advocate for members.
